C13H11NO2 — CID 177120866
2,3-dimethoxynaphthalene-1-carbonitrile (PubChem CID 177120866) has the molecular formula C13H11NO2 and a molecular weight of 212.24 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2,3-dimethoxynaphthalene-1-carbonitrile.
